Output e4a650fa3a10cc90d13c6bd55456368e08e8d6bc18c361589d19a0e256232437:5

value
5914059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827032560d5ad2091159b6e2cba1cd7097a4a154 OP_EQUAL
address
3DaiB3GXwuYRh9mBjbnbbw2LC7n1LEBhEJ
transaction
e4a650fa3a10cc90d13c6bd55456368e08e8d6bc18c361589d19a0e256232437
spent
true